The first two bits of the CONNECTION_STATUS data type contain the
RunMode and ConnectionFaulted status bits of a device. Ta b le 3
describes the
combinations of the RunMode and ConnectionFaulted states.
Input and Output Diagnostics
Guard I/O modules provide pulse test and monitoring capabilities. If the
module detects a failure, it sets the offending input or output to its safe state
and reports the failure to the controller. The failure indication is made via
input or output status and is maintained for a configurable amount of time
after the failure is repaired.
Table 3 - Safety Connection Status
RunMode
Status
ConnectionFaulted
Status
Safety Connection Operation
1 = Run 0 = Valid The producing device is actively controlling the data. The producing
device is in Run mode.
0 = Idle 0 = Valid The connection is active and the producing device is in the Idle state.
The safety data is reset to safe state.
0 = Idle 1 = Faulted The safety connection is faulted. The state of the producing device is
unknown. The safety data is reset to safe state.
1 1 Invalid state.
ATTENTION: Safety I/O connections and produced/consumed connections
cannot be automatically configured to fault the controller if a connection is
lost and the system transitions to the safe state. Therefore, if you must detect
a device fault to be sure that the system maintains the required SIL level, you
must monitor the Safety I/O CONNECTION_STATUS bits and initiate the fault
via program logic.
IMPORTANT You are responsible for providing application logic to latch these I/O failures
and to verify that the system restarts properly.
